Discuss the guidelines for providing an effective prompt

What will be an ideal response?


Effective prompts should include the following components:
1) Focus the student's attention to the discriminative stimulus
2) Prompts should be as weak as possible
3) Prompts should be faded as quickly as possible
4) Avoid unplanned prompts.
